Global meat production in Chile
Chile: Global meat production was 1.56 million tonnes in 2024. ◆ Volatile
Global meat production in Chile, 1961–2024
Source: Food and Agriculture Organization of the United Nations (2025) – with major processing by Our World in Data. Measured in tonnes.
Analysis
In 2024, global meat production in Chile stood at 1.56 million tonnes.
That represents a change of up 0.8% on the previous year and up 9.3% over ten years.
Over the whole period, global meat production in Chile peaked at 1.59 million tonnes in 2020 and was at its lowest, 211,500 tonnes, in 1973.
That places Chile 37th out of 201 countries with data for 2024, putting it in the top quarter.
The series is highly variable year to year, so single readings are best treated with caution.
Averages by decade
| Decade | Average | Lowest | Highest | Years |
|---|---|---|---|---|
| 1960s | 251,514 tonnes | 212,157 tonnes | 301,467 tonnes | 9 |
| 1970s | 284,285 tonnes | 211,500 tonnes | 319,708 tonnes | 10 |
| 1980s | 388,978 tonnes | 343,775 tonnes | 473,174 tonnes | 10 |
| 1990s | 718,599 tonnes | 519,960 tonnes | 895,675 tonnes | 10 |
| 2000s | 1.18 million tonnes | 945,521 tonnes | 1.40 million tonnes | 10 |
| 2010s | 1.45 million tonnes | 1.33 million tonnes | 1.53 million tonnes | 10 |
| 2020s | 1.57 million tonnes | 1.55 million tonnes | 1.59 million tonnes | 5 |
